Remove barricades outside Hamza?s residence: SC
LAHORE: Chief Justice of Pakistan Mian Saqib Nisar on Sunday, outraged at closure of roads outside the residence of Punjab chief minister?s son Hamza Shahbaz in Model Town, ordered Punjab chief secretary to remove all hurdles put in the name of security and open the roads to public immediately.
Hearing a suo moto notice into closure of roads in the name of security, the CJP remarked that if they felt threatened, they should relocate their houses to some other places where they feel safe. ?I am the Chief Justice of Pakistan, but I don?t need barricades to protect me and no such hurdles have been placed outside my residence,? the CJP angrily told the chief secretary. The chief justice got infuriated after the chief secretary told the court that the gate which was installed to block the road has been removed in compliance with the court?s order but the barricades are still in place. The CJP admonished the chief secretary for failing to obey the orders and sought explanation for not opening the roads. The chief secretary said the zigzag barricades had been placed outside Hamza Shahbaz?s residence as he had been receiving life threats continuously. ?Who is he? I don?t know him. If he feels threatened, he should relocate to place of his choice?.
